Wainer dos Santos Moschetta <address@hidden> writes:

> The acceptance tests build on Travis is configured to print
> the entire Avocado's job log in case any test fail. Usually one is
> interested on failed tests only though. So this change the Travis
> configuration in order to show the log of tests which status is
> different from 'PASS' and 'SKIP' only. Note that 'CANCEL'-ed tests
> will have the log printed too because it can help to debug some
> condition on CI environment which is not being fulfilled.
